Transaction eca28c8231fc729810b18c43ad6238e67a9c7744e431105326b6aa265f094559
1 Input
1 Output
-
eca28c8231fc729810b18c43ad6238e67a9c7744e431105326b6aa265f094559:0
- value
- 13174
- script pubkey
- OP_0 OP_PUSHBYTES_20 1fea2fbe366ae52626d2dbeb2ed276196199260c
- address
- bc1qrl4zl03kdtjjvfkjm04ja5nkr9sejfsvd26uyu